IT Support Specialist - posted May 10th 2012

The Lake Louise Ski Area Ltd. is looking to fill the fulltime year around position of

IT Support Specialist

Reporting to theIT Supervisor, the ideal candidate will be a positive, outgoing and self-motivated individual well versed in a broad range of IT disciplines.  This position will include working on major IT projects during the summer and will be focused on support during the winter.  An excellent verbal and written communicator, the successful candidate will work with other members of the Information Technology team to support and maintain the technologies at The Lake Louise Ski Area.  This is a full-time, year-round position based in Lake Louise, Alberta.  Normal work weeks include four (4) shifts of ten (10) hours each from 0730h to 1800h including one unpaid thirty (30) minute lunch break per shift.  Shifts will include most holidays and weekends and may include evenings and/or nights as required.

Required Skills and Competencies

  • Excellent communication skills verbally and in writing
  • Friendly, approachable and self-motivated
  • Able to prioritize, multitask and deal with stressful situations
  • Thorough understanding of common PC hardware and associated peripherals; must be able to troubleshoot and resolve common hardware issues independently
  • Expert working knowledge of common Microsoft operating systems (Windows 7, Windows XP) and applications (Microsoft Office suite)
  • Thorough understanding of computer networking and the ability to set-up, troubleshoot and maintain end-user equipment in a networked environment
  • Familiar with TCP/IP, subnetting, routing, VLANs and be capable of performing basic administration of network equipment including switches
  • Willing and able to ski or snowboard to access various locations around the ski area as required
  • Well-versed in current IT trends; interested in developing, implementing and supporting emerging technologies

Additional Experience and Assets

  • Familiar with installation and maintenance of Campus Area Networks including OSP (Outside Plant Cabling), trenching, copper and fiber-optic cabling installation
  • Experience with structured cabling systems (copper and fiber-optic), equipment rack and device installation, operating and maintenance
  • Understanding of Radio Frequency system concepts, particularly in analog VHF and microwave (802.11n) bands
  • Able to setup, operate and maintain audio / video systems including satellite receivers, Cable TV headends, structured audio systems, mixers, speaker processors, amplifiers and speakers
  • Telephony experience, particularly experience performing moves, adds and changes in a PBX and/or VoIP environment
  • Experience with Linux (CentOS, Ubuntu) servers, ability to perform basic administration and shell scripting
  • Programming skills and/or experience (particularly PHP, Java)
  • SQL experience (MySQL or MS-SQL); able to perform basic SQL queries involving multiple tables
  • Familiarity and/or experience with Microsoft Active Directory and Microsoft Exchange
  • Experience working in a structured helpdesk environment (able to manage and prioritize tasks and communicate effectively through service desk software)
  • Experience with Symantec Backup Exec, tape backup systems and disaster recovery planning

Additional Information

  • Follow all LLSA policies and procedures
  • Complete other tasks as assigned in a timely manner
  • A three month probationary period applies
  • A police background check, from your home country or province, will be required upon commencement of employment
  • The wage is $23.55 / hr

IT Supervisor - posted May 10th 2012

 

The Lake Louise Ski Area Ltd. is looking to fill the fulltime year around position of

IT Supervisor

Reporting to theIT Director and responsible for day-to-day operation of all Information Technologies at the Lake Louise Ski Area, the IT Supervisor will be a positive, outgoing and self-motivated individual who works well with others and has demonstrated superior supervisory and technical skills in progressively responsible IT positions.  An excellent verbal and written communicator, the successful candidate will both supervise and work alongside other members of the Information Technology team; implementing, supporting and maintaining technologies at The Lake Louise Ski Area.  This is a full-time, year-round position based in Lake Louise, Alberta.  Normal work weeks include four (4) shifts of ten (10) hours each from 0730h to 1800h including one unpaid thirty (30) minute lunch break per shift.  Shifts will include most holidays and weekends and may include evenings and/or nights as required.

Required Skills and Competencies

  • Minimum two (2) years supervisory experience in an Information Technology related position (team lead, etc. also acceptable)
  • Diploma or degree in an IT related discipline –OR- five (5) years relevant experience in progressively responsible IT positions
  • Friendly, approachable and able to motivate self and others; leads by example
  • Excellent communication skills verbally and in writing; must be willing and able to produce technical documentation that is accurate and easy to understand and follow
  • Able to prioritize, multitask, and set daily priorities for the department independently
  • Thorough understanding of common PC hardware and associated peripherals; must be able to document and explain hardware setup and troubleshooting procedures
  • Thorough understanding of common Microsoft operating systems (Windows 7, Windows XP) and applications (Microsoft Office suite)
  • MS-SQL experience; able to run moderately complex queries involving multiple tables
  • Familiar with Microsoft Active Directory and Exchange Server
  • Expert understanding of computer networking including the ability to design, install, program, maintain and document routed networks
  • Willing and able to ski or snowboard to access various locations around the ski area as required

Additional Experience and Assets

  • Experience in setting daily priorities for IT department and following through to ensure that key metrics are met
  • Ability to contribute to the development of IT strategy and departmental budgets
  • Experience dealing with suppliers and vendors
  • IT project management experience
  • Familiar with the design, planning, installation and maintenance of Campus Area Networks including OSP (Outside Plant Cabling), trenching, copper and fiber-optic cabling
  • Experience with structured cabling systems (copper and fiber-optic), equipment rack and device installation, operating and maintenance
  • Understanding of Radio Frequency system concepts, particularly in analog VHF and microwave (802.11n) bands
  • Understanding of audio / video systems including satellite receivers, Cable TV headends, structured audio systems, mixers, speaker processors, amplifiers and speakers
  • Telephony experience, particularly experience performing moves, adds and changes in a PBX and/or VoIP environment
  • Experience with Linux (CentOS, Ubuntu) servers, ability to perform basic administration and shell scripting
  • Experience with Symantec Backup Exec, tape backup systems and disaster recovery planning

Additional Information

  • Follow all LLSA policies and procedures
  • Complete other tasks as assigned in a timely manner
  • A three month probationary period applies
  • A police background check, from your home country or province, will be required upon commencement of employment
  • The wage is $28.37 / hr

Heavy Duty or Auto Mechanic - posted May 9th 2012

The Lake Louise Ski Area Ltd. are looking to fill the fulltime year round position of

                      Heavy Duty or Auto Mechanic

 Reporting to the Vehicle Maintenance Supervisor, some of the requirements/responsibilities of the position include, but are not limited to:

 

  • Regular & unscheduled inspections and maintenance of all wheeled vehicles, over snow equipment, and stationary engines
  • Must be knowledgeable and show a proficient ability to troubleshoot and work with and repair electrical systems, hydrostatic drive systems, hydraulic systems, and light truck equipment.
  • Participate in maintaining a high standard of safety
  • Assist in all vehicle and equipment maintenance projects and work with contractors as required
  • Operate all fleet vehicles in order to evaluate the results of previously performed maintenance
  • Complete work orders and projects as assigned
  • Accurate record keeping of regular inspections, maintenance, and projects
  • Work closely with Mountain Operations, Mechanical Services, Parts / Purchasing, and in cooperation with all other resort departments
  • Must have the ability to work outside in all weather conditions.
  • Must possess accurate verbal and written communication skills.
  • Must be able to lift 50 lbs
  • 3rd,4th year Apprentice or Journeyman Mechanic
  • Safety oriented
  • Able to work supervised & unsupervised
  • Able to prioritize tasks for efficiency
  • Follow all LLSA policies and procedures
  • Adhere to LLSA grooming policy at all times
  • Complete other tasks as assigned
  • A three month probationary period applies
  • A police background check, from your home country or province, will be required upon commencement of employment

Housing Manager - posted April 25th 2012

The Lake Louise Ski Area is looking to fill the fulltime year round position of

Housing Manager

 Some of the requirements/responsibilities of the position include, but are not limited to:

  • Responsible for overseeing the day-to-day housing operations, and ensuring the operation runs smoothly and efficiently in all of our 5 properties, and all rental properties
  • Abide by housing and employment standards in all aspects of the Housing Department
  • Ongoing training & supervision of all Housing staff including security
  • Manage the departments wage slips, terminations and payroll requirements
  • Provide reports and information to senior management as needed
  • Develop systems that stress the importance of accountability, consistency and procedure
  • Acquire and secure outside rental agreements with local businesses in our off season
  • Ensure compliance of the Housing contract with all tenants and ability to address housing concerns and issues consistently and in a fair manner
  • Ensure that steps are taken to ensure the health and safety of those in residence
  • Determine and prioritize housing needs in consultation with managers and developing programs to encourage clean and safe living spaces
  • Controlling and participation in all check-ins/outs and room inspections
  • Communication with the payroll department regarding housing rates and charges to tenants
  • Maintain logs and statistical information on maintenance and construction projects that are taking place, or in the future in all LLSA housing
  • Follow all LLSA policies and procedures
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Excellent conflict resolution, crisis intervention skills and problem solving ability
  • Must be highly organized with the staffing and administration of the department
  • Advanced knowledge of Word, Excel, and Power Point
  • Ability to balance the needs of staff, managers, and outside interests
  • Must possess excellent previous management and leadership experience
  • A three month probationary period applies
  • A police background check, from your home country or province, will be required upon commencement of employment
  • Wage for this position is $17.50 per hour

Assistant Maintenance Manager - posted April 25th 2012

The Lake Louise Ski Area Ltd. is looking to fill the fulltime year round position of

 Assistant Maintenance Manager

The ideal candidate will report to the Maintenance Manager and is responsible for ensuring the smooth and efficient day-to-day operations of the Maintenance Departments

Some of the requirements/responsibilities of the position include, but are not limited to:

  • Active involvement in the routine and non-routine maintenance as well as upgrades to all ski lifts, lodges and buildings, this involves a considerable amount of outdoor, on-mountain tasks
  • Accurate record keeping of routine and non-routine inspections, maintenance, and projects
  • Follow OH&S responsibility and code related requirements
  • Manage and expand the existing preventative maintenance system
  • Prepare and follow budgets for personnel operations/ payroll tracking
  • Strong communication and problem solving skills
  • Must possess a valid drivers license
  • Minimum of 3 years experience in Mechanical Maintenance required.
  • Computer literacy, proficient in MS Word, Excel, PowerPoint and Outlook.
  • Excellent time management and project management skills.
  • Ability to interpret and implement company policies and procedures
  • Demonstrated ability to exercise necessary cost control measures
  • Highly flexible, with solid interpersonal skills that allow one to work effectively in a diverse working environment
  • Physical ability to lift up to 75lb
  • Ability to work at heights
  • Complete other tasks as assigned
  • A police background check, from your home country or province, will be required upon commencement of employment
